Volvo A40F articulated dumper
A short demo of my 1:14 scale Volvo articulated dumper 6x6 wheel drive. The dumper tipping mechanism is a spindel motor system from Carson Germany.
The drive motor is a 6 V geared motor from Conrad electronics. The articulated turning mechanism uses 2 13/70 electric cylinders from CTI Germany. I may be swapping the electric cylinders with real hydraulic ones. Here is a pic of it beside a Fumotec model to the left Last edited by kenobi; 12-30-2013 at 01:56 PM. |

As regards the CTI cylinders, they can be a bit hit and miss and I can not yet figure out why they sometimes do not work. Some days they work without a glitch , other days they suddenly stop working intermittently. Each cylinder piston is capable of 4 kg push and pull , that's 8 kg working together which should be more than enough for steering. I am running them on 3 Cell lipos but I am tempted to try 4 cells . |
